  1. One day a man went to Listowel. It was a fair day. When the evening came he said he would wait for the dance. He waited and not long before that his cousin was buried. However, when he was coming home after the dance he saw a light inside in the field at the left side. He drove on quickly thinking he might be on before the light would be out on the road, but the light was out to the road just as soon as himself. He had a bottle of holy water and a Rosary Beads in his pocket. He took out both and blessed himself and kept his Rosary beads round his neck. Then he heard his cousin that was dead talking to him and he never answered him. Then the light disappeared and the man went home. He was just inside in bed when he was called three times again and he never answered.
